Snapshot
As Commercial Manager based in our HQ in Sydney, you will report to the Associate Commercial Director and play a key role within the Development team, leading the negotiation, execution and ongoing management of critical contracts across AirTrunk's hyperscale data centre projects. Working closely with teams and leadership across APJ, you will make your mark in a number of ways:
You will lead complex contract negotiations, particularly MSAs with General Contractors and OSE vendors, ensuring commercial and legal positions are optimised and risk is effectively managed
You will act as a trusted commercial and contractual advisor to internal stakeholders, providing clear guidance on contract terms, risk allocation and negotiation strategy
You will help shape and continuously improve AirTrunk's contracting frameworks, templates, governance and procurement practices at scale
What you'll do
Lead the drafting, review, negotiation and execution of contracts, with a strong focus on risk allocation, legal robustness and commercial outcomes
Drive MSA and key supplier negotiations, working closely with internal stakeholders to align on strategy, positions and approvals
Manage contractual correspondence, variations, claims and dispute resolution processes where required
Oversee contract governance processes, including approvals, compliance with internal frameworks and accurate documentation of negotiated positions
Support purchase order and cost management workflows, ensuring alignment with contractual terms and commercial intent
Provide clear, practical advice to Development, Finance and delivery teams on contractual matters, commercial risk and mitigation options
Identify , assess and proactively manage contractual risks and issues across the full project lifecycle
Contribute to the refinement of standard contract templates, negotiation playbooks and procurement practices to increase consistency, speed and commercial discipline
